Book Review: Interview with the Vampire

Interview with the Vampire is a book that takes us back to the good old days when vampire romance was good, blood flowed freely, corpses piled up like cordwood, and decades passed in each chapter. And although this book has more flowery language than I usually like, I'm not going to bash it for that. Here's my review!

Positives
Interview with the Vampire is in an interesting narrative style. It's written as... well... an interview. It's written as an interview between a vampire and a reporter. It feels interesting, because it's like the vampire is talking right to us for the whole book. Next is the creep factor. Some of the events are freaky just because they happen. Not gory, just freaky.

Neutral
There were times where I would wind up missing chunks of the narrative. Not because I'd accidentally skip forward on something or focus too much on what I was doing while I had my earbuds in. Just because the events in the book weren't super compelling. Some of the details don't grab you by the throat (so to speak) and drive you forward.

Negatives
Going along with the missing time from the previous paragraph, there were only a couple of times where I was actively thinking "well, get on with it." The bigger problem were the times when I would get confused with names that were a little close to other names, or when characters would change locations, but still refer to previous ones, i.e. spending time in Paris, but referring to streets in New Orleans, etc. Those got confusing, and it threw me out, but it fit within the character, so I can see that it fit.

Overall
My feelings on this are that it has certainly earned its place as a classic vampire story, although I'm not sure why it's held up as a beacon of one of the best. It's very good, to be sure. And I'm sure it's one of the best. But there are a lot of them out there. I'm sure a few are contenders for the king of the hill. This is one of the giants, but hasn't aged well. But if you see far, it's because you stand on their shoulders.

I give Interview with the Vampire 6/10
